Frequently asked questions about Sussex Ct

  • Is Eldersburg a buyer's or seller's market?
    Eldersburg is currently a seller's market, based on recent for-sale activity.
  • What's the median sale price in Eldersburg?
    The median sale price in Eldersburg is $546K. That is up $9.17K from the prior month.
  • What do residents say about Eldersburg?
    Residents describe Eldersburg, MD as easy to park in, dog-friendly, and well-kept. Most residents say you need a car. See recently sold homes in Eldersburg, MD.
  • What are the closest schools to Sussex Ct?
    The closest schools to Sussex Ct in Eldersburg, MD are Century High School (rated 9/10), Eldersburg Elementary School (Pre-K, rated 8/10), Sykesville Middle School (rated 7/10).
